Common Misconceptions Concerning Assessment Regularity



One typical misconception regarding inspection regularity is that conducting assessments just when there are visible indicators of pests suffices. While waiting on noticeable indications might seem like an affordable method, pests can often remain concealed up until their numbers have actually significantly boosted, making it more difficult and much more costly to eliminate them.

Regular examinations, also in the absence of obvious insect discoveries, can aid spot problems in their onset, avoiding considerable damage to your home.

Performance of Preventative Measures



To effectively manage parasite infestations, applying preventative actions is essential in preserving a pest-free atmosphere. Right here are four necessary actions you can require to maintain pests away:

1. ** Seal Entrance Points: ** Conduct an extensive evaluation of your home to determine and secure any kind of fractures or openings where bugs can get in. Usage caulk or weather condition removing to secure spaces around windows, doors, pipelines, and vents.

2. ** Appropriate Food Storage: ** Store food in closed containers and ensure that your pantry and kitchen area are clean and devoid of crumbs. On a regular basis clean counter tops, tables, and floorings to remove food sources that bring in parasites.

3. ** Lower Moisture: ** Insects are drawn in to water resources, so repair any dripping faucets, pipelines, or home appliances. Usage dehumidifiers in wet areas like cellars and attic rooms to decrease moisture levels.
